Latest news

Classic list

Globally incubate standards compliant channels before scalable benefits. Quickly disseminate superior deliverables whereas web-enabled applications.

29/Ago/2024

Throughout troughs, organizations benefit from lowered costs via the scaling down of sources without dropping service high quality. Effective planning for both instances helps groups better navigate essential resource utilization intervals. Google’s cloud researchers lately discovered that many firms with on-premises environments waste as a lot as two-thirds of their put in capacities, losing cash and obtainable computing assets.

elasticity and scalability in cloud computing

We check every product thoroughly and provides excessive marks to solely the easiest.

Cloud elasticity is the flexibility of a cloud computing environment to dynamically scale resource allocation up or down in response to fluctuating demand. It involves automated expansion or contraction of computing resources what are ai chips used for to make sure an application’s performance is consistent with consumer expectations whereas maintaining value efficiency. An everyday real-world instance of cloud infrastructure is a streaming video service.

Cloud infrastructure contains rather more than simply servers in an information middle. It’s the cloud’s way of claiming, “I’ve got you,” adapting to your wants in actual time. Elasticity permits your cloud companies to increase instantly to handle the site visitors spike after which shrink again down when issues cool off, making certain you’re not paying greater than you need.

Discover the differences between scalability and elasticity in cloud computing and discover methods to boost system performance. Related to how a restaurant will add or scale back seating capacity inside based on the site visitors they get in real-time, cloud elasticity is about expanding or shrinking computing power inside a server’s limitations. It permits corporations to add new parts to their current infrastructure to cope with ever-increasing workload demands. However, this horizontal scaling is designed for the lengthy run and helps meet present and future resource needs, with plenty of room for expansion. As mentioned earlier, cloud elasticity refers to scaling up (or scaling down) the computing capability as wanted. It principally helps you understand how properly your structure can adapt to the workload in actual time.

In the past, a system’s scalability relied on the company’s hardware, and thus, was severely restricted in sources. With the adoption of cloud computing, scalability has turn into far more available and simpler Scalability vs Elasticity. Not Like elasticity, which is more of makeshift resource allocation – cloud scalability is part of infrastructure design. Methods are getting good sufficient to handle resource allocation with little assistance from people, due to this fact automation in terms of scalability and elasticity is set to extend. In cloud computing, the choice between scalability and elasticity principally comes right down to the distinctive wants and circumstances of your corporation. An elastic cloud supplier screens useful resource utilization and accordingly allocates depending on the demand which saves you from investing in pointless underutilized or overutilized assets.

If you relied on scalability alone, the site visitors spike could quickly overwhelm your provisioned virtual machine, inflicting service outages. Cloud computing provides vital advantages over on-premises computing, together with the ability to increase operations with out purchasing new hardware. Although load balancing tools are primarily used to make sure uniform traffic distribution across a fleet of instances, in addition they communicate with autoscalers to adjust the fleet measurement as wanted. Containerization instruments like Docker let you package software in a method that makes it readily reproducible throughout varied platforms.

It’s an incredibly broad category, applied to almost anything accessed over the web—for example, pictures stored in a backup service, an enterprise CRM or ERP suite, or a GenAI-enabled database as a service. Providers of enterprise-class services can’t danger it, which is why many of these systems are built on hyperscale cloud infrastructure. Digital demands can surge in a single day, making cloud elasticity an essential tool for various companies.

Consistency in model messaging should be maintained since it helps the public understand and like the product. Increase your team’s performance with tried and tested methods designed to improve work effectivity. This suggestions highlights the elasticity of Wrike in action, showcasing how it adeptly helps the swift workflow essential to a company’s success. Compare the 2 primarily based on various factors and assess your needs earlier than making the ultimate call. Moreover, as a outcome of they can be shortly spun up or down to meet wants, they facilitate elasticity.

The future of cloud scalability will involve seamless useful resource allocation throughout the entire computing continuum—from edge devices to regional data centers to international cloud resources. Elastic cloud options excel at sustaining consistent performance no matter workload fluctuations. By routinely detecting elevated demand and provisioning additional assets, these environments stop efficiency degradation throughout traffic spikes that may otherwise crash fixed-capacity techniques.

What Is The Objective Of Cloud Elasticity?

  • The banks and buying and selling platforms exploit the cloud elasticity to augment peak transaction hundreds in order that monetary transactions and market data processing could be performed securely and in real-time.
  • Cloud methods can successfully deal with workload fluctuations, analyze data, and supply a dependable service to customers by scaling their assets.
  • As A Result Of demand for cloud computing providers can ebb and circulate, flexibility is essential.
  • Cloud computing elasticity is the aptitude to adjust sources depending on demand, allowing companies to easily handle altering workloads.
  • Aleksander Hougen, the co-chief editor at Cloudwards, is a seasoned professional in cloud storage, digital safety and VPNs, with an academic background in software program engineering.
  • On the flip side, you can even add multiple servers to a single server and scale out to reinforce server efficiency and meet the rising demand.

Elasticity permits the system to allocate further resources quickly to handle the spike and then launch them once the visitors subsides. This flexibility minimizes prices whereas ensuring efficiency during unpredictable demand fluctuations. Cloud elasticity refers back to the capability of a cloud-based computing setting to dynamically allocate and de-allocate resources on demand. This “on-the-fly” capability permits for the environment friendly administration of sudden peaks and lows in computing demand.

elasticity and scalability in cloud computing

Optimized Price Management

With SaaS, software is managed by the service provider, and the ability to scale, new features, and safety updates are delivered automatically. Inside a cloud information middle, the provider configures the necessary hardware. As environmental issues acquire prominence, future elasticity mechanisms will increasingly incorporate sustainability metrics into their decision-making processes. Somewhat than optimizing solely for efficiency and cost, cloud scaling systems may also contemplate power efficiency and carbon footprint.

Delay In Provisioning

Elasticity and scalability cater to completely different features of useful resource management in cloud computing. Cloud elasticity is in regards to the responsive and computerized https://www.globalcloudteam.com/ scaling of sources to match present demand ranges, good for transient or unpredictable workloads. Upgrading an present machine is a simple and direct answer to performance issues. By enhancing a server’s resources, workloads stay localized to the identical machine, avoiding the complexities of provisioning a new machine and redistributing knowledge. Many cloud providers additional streamline this process by providing intuitive dashboards and APIs, allowing IT teams to scale vertically with minimal guide effort.

SaaS refers to software delivered over the web, normally by way of an internet browser or a front-end utility, similar to a smartphone. In Style examples of SaaS embrace video and audio streaming, on-line gaming, and personal cloud storage. On the enterprise facet, departments organizationwide, including HR, finance, and marketing, can profit from purposes delivered through the cloud.

These services require a scalable foundation that optimizes compute efficiency and provides storage on demand while maximizing availability for the top customer. A firm similar to Netflix has hundreds of servers internationally for a mixture of redundancy and minimal latency thanks to geographic proximity between user and server. Elasticity and scalability every play an essential role in cloud computing at present.


13/Ago/2024

Master MS Excel for knowledge evaluation with key formulas, capabilities, and LookUp instruments on this comprehensive course. Discover practical solutions, advanced retrieval methods, and agentic RAG techniques to enhance context, relevance, and accuracy in AI-driven functions. Master Massive Language Models (LLMs) with this course, providing clear steerage in NLP and model training made simple.

Switch Studying – Day 29

This makes it well-suited for optimizing deep networks the place gradients can vary significantly across layers. At the tip of the earlier part, you learned why there may be better choices than using gradient descent on huge information. To deal with AI Agents the challenges giant datasets pose, we’ve stochastic gradient descent, a well-liked method among optimizers in deep studying. The time period stochastic denotes the factor of randomness upon which the algorithm relies.

It is more reliable than gradient descent algorithms and their variants, and it reaches convergence at a higher velocity. This property allows AdaGrad (and other related gradient-squared-based methods like RMSProp and Adam) to flee a saddle point much better. Sometimes, vanilla gradient descent might simply cease on the saddle point the place gradients in each directions are zero and be perfectly content material there. Let’s consider two extreme instances to know this decay fee parameter higher. If the decay fee is zero, then it’s precisely the same as (vanilla) gradient descent. Usually the decay price is chosen round zero.8–0.9 — it’s like a surface with somewhat bit of friction so it will definitely slows down and stops.

It is sensible to decelerate when were are nearing a minima, and we wish to converge into it. But contemplate the purpose where gradient descent enters the region of pathological curvature, and the sheer distance to go until the minima. If we use a slower learning price, it might take so too much time to get to the minima. As it seems, naive gradient descent just isn’t often a preferable choice for training a deep community because of its sluggish convergence price. This became a motivation for researchers to develop optimization algorithms which accelerate gradient descent.

In the context of machine studying, the objective of gradient descent is often to reduce the loss operate for a machine studying downside. A good algorithm finds the minimal fast and reliably nicely (i.e. it doesn’t get caught in local minima, saddle factors, or plateau areas, but somewhat goes for the global minimum). Beneath the hood, Adagrad accumulates element-wise squares dw² of gradients from all earlier iterations. During weight update, instead of using regular studying rate α, AdaGrad scales it by dividing α by the sq. root of the amassed gradients √vₜ. Additionally, a small constructive term ε is added to the denominator to stop potential division by zero. The benefit of using Adagrad is that it abolishes the want to modify the training fee manually.

RMSProp vs Adam

Rmsprop Vs Standard Gradient Descent

RMSProp vs Adam

Because of this, mini-batch gradient descent is ideal and supplies an excellent balance between speed and accuracy. RMSprop builds on the constraints of normal gradient descent by adjusting the educational rate dynamically for every parameter. It maintains a transferring common of squared gradients to normalize the updates, preventing drastic studying rate fluctuations.

This may also make issues easier after we introduce the Adam algorithm later. For an replace, this adds to the element alongside w2, whereas zeroing out the part in w1 direction. For this reason, momentum is also referred to as a technique which dampens oscillations in our search. It only takes the first order derivatives of the loss operate into consideration and not the higher ones. What this principally rmsprop means it has no clue in regards to the curvature of the loss perform.

Iteration Four

  • Hence, this will help us keep away from bouncing between the ridges, and transfer in the course of the minima.
  • If gradients comparable to a certain weight vector element are giant, then the respective studying price will be small.
  • Underneath the hood, Adagrad accumulates element-wise squares dw² of gradients from all earlier iterations.
  • Nevertheless, SGD with momentum appears to search out more flatter minima than Adam, whereas adaptive strategies are probably to converge quickly in the path of sharper minima.
  • The above visualizations create a greater picture in thoughts and help in evaluating the results of assorted optimization algorithms.
  • An optimization algorithm finds the value of the parameters (weights) that decrease the error when mapping inputs to outputs.

This occurs as a result of gradient descent solely cares in regards to the gradient, which is similar at the purple level for the entire three curves above. Take into consideration double by-product, or the speed of how shortly the gradient is changing. This stabilizes coaching by dampening oscillations, making it effective for non-stationary problems like RNNs and reinforcement learning. The Foundation Mean Squared propagation algorithm looks extremely much like momentum approach we outlined above.

This is as a end result of https://www.globalcloudteam.com/ the squared gradients within the denominator hold accumulating, and thus the denominator half keeps on rising. Small learning charges prevent the mannequin from acquiring more knowledge, which compromises its accuracy. To see the impact of the decaying, on this head-to-head comparability, AdaGrad white) retains up with RMSProp (green) initially, as expected with the tuned studying fee and decay fee. But the sums of gradient squared for AdaGrad accumulate so fast that they soon turn out to be humongous (demonstrated by the sizes of the squares in the animation). They take a heavy toll and ultimately AdaGrad practically stops shifting. RMSProp, then again, has stored the squares under a manageable measurement the whole time, because of the decay fee.

These algorithms, especially for ADAM, have achieved much sooner convergence pace than vanilla SGD in follow. The problem with RPPROP is that it doesn’t work nicely with giant datasets and when we need to carry out mini-batch updates. So, reaching the robustness of RPPROP and the effectivity of mini-batches simultaneously was the primary motivation behind the rise of RMS prop. RMS prop is an advancement in AdaGrad optimizer because it reduces the monotonically decreasing studying rate.

This technique is particularly useful for models dealing with sparse or noisy gradients, similar to recurrent neural networks (RNNs). Optimizers like Adam and RMSprop are algorithms that adjust the parameters of a neural community throughout coaching to minimize the loss perform. Whereas they share similarities, they differ in how they compute and apply these adaptive updates. A. AI enhances deep learning optimizers by automating and bettering neural network coaching utilizing algorithms like gradient descent, adaptive studying rates, and momentum.



Visítanos en las redes sociales.:


Fijo +51-1- 4344000

Cel. 954756600


Llámenos ante cualquier duda sobre los servicios que brindamos o nuestros productos en venta.


Copyright Meditek Perú 2018. Todos los derechos reservados.